本発明は、足場を建築物の外壁部に対向させて設けてある建築用足場に関する。   The present invention relates to a building scaffold provided with a scaffold facing an outer wall of a building.

従来の建築用足場は、建築物に対する相対位置が移動しないように足場を設けてあるので(例えば、特許文献1〜4参照)、足場を建築物の外壁部に対向させて設けてある建築用足場では、風荷重などによる足場の外壁部に対する遠近方向への転倒を確実に防止できるように、足場を建築物側にも一体固定している。   Since a conventional building scaffold is provided with a scaffold so that the relative position with respect to the building does not move (see, for example, Patent Documents 1 to 4), the scaffold is provided to face the outer wall of the building. In the scaffolding, the scaffolding is also integrally fixed to the building side so as to surely prevent the outer wall of the scaffolding from falling in the perspective direction due to wind loads or the like.

特許第2955251号公報Japanese Patent No. 2955251 特公平6−58008号公報Japanese Patent Publication No. 6-58008 特開平9−310481号公報JP-A-9-310481 特開平10−18582号公報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 10-18582

このため、例えば、建築物を足場に対して水平方向に移動させながら施工する、所謂、トラベリング工法などのように、足場と外壁部とを互いに対向させて水平方向に相対移動可能に設けてある建築用足場では、足場を建築物側に一体固定できないので、高さが高くなるほど転倒モーメントが大きい大型の足場を設けたり、足場を支える支柱などの転倒防止用構造物を別途設置したりして、風荷重などによる足場の外壁部に対する遠近方向への転倒を確実に防止する必要があり、大量の足場用資材が必要になったり、外壁部に沿って足場設置用の広いスペースを確保する必要があるという欠点がある。
本発明は上記実情に鑑みてなされたものであって、足場と外壁部とを互いに対向させて水平方向に相対移動可能に設けてある建築用足場でありながら、大量の足場用資材を特に使用したり、外壁部に沿って足場設置用の広いスペースを特に確保する必要なく、風荷重などによる足場の外壁部に対する遠近方向への転倒を確実に防止できるようにすることを目的とする。
For this reason, for example, the construction is carried out while moving the building in the horizontal direction with respect to the scaffold, so that the scaffold and the outer wall are opposed to each other so as to be relatively movable in the horizontal direction. In building scaffolds, the scaffold cannot be fixed integrally to the building side, so a large scaffold with a larger falling moment as the height increases, or a structure for preventing falls such as a column supporting the scaffold is installed separately. It is necessary to surely prevent the scaffold from falling in the perspective direction due to wind loads, etc., and a large amount of scaffolding material is required, or a large space for installing the scaffold along the outer wall is required. There is a drawback that there is.
The present invention has been made in view of the above circumstances, and particularly a large amount of scaffolding material is used while the scaffold and the outer wall are opposed to each other and are provided for relative movement in the horizontal direction. The purpose of the present invention is to reliably prevent the scaffold from falling in the perspective direction with respect to the outer wall portion due to wind load or the like without having to secure a wide space for installing the scaffold along the outer wall portion.

本発明の第1特徴構成は、足場を建築物の外壁部に対向させて設けてある建築用足場であって、前記足場と前記外壁部とを、互いに対向させた姿勢で、水平方向に相対移動可能に設け、前記足場と前記外壁部とを前記足場の前記外壁部に対する遠近方向への倒れを阻止可能に係合する係合機構を、前記相対移動方向に沿わせて前記足場に固定したガイドレールとそのガイドレールに係合するように前記外壁部に着脱自在に固定した係合部材により構成し、前記足場と前記外壁部との相対移動方向に沿ってその相対移動を許容するように設けてある点にある。 A first characteristic configuration of the present invention is a building scaffold provided with a scaffold facing an outer wall portion of a building, wherein the scaffold and the outer wall portion are opposed to each other in the horizontal direction. An engagement mechanism that is movably provided and engages the scaffold and the outer wall portion so as to prevent the scaffold from falling in a perspective direction with respect to the outer wall portion is fixed to the scaffold along the relative movement direction. A guide rail and an engaging member that is detachably fixed to the outer wall so as to engage with the guide rail are configured to allow relative movement along the relative movement direction of the scaffold and the outer wall. It is in the point provided.

〔作用及び効果〕
足場と外壁部とを互いに固定することなく、足場と外壁部とを、互いに対向させた姿勢で、水平方向に相対移動可能に設け、その足場と外壁部とを足場の外壁部に対する遠近方向への倒れを阻止可能に係合する係合機構を、足場と外壁部との相対移動方向に沿ってその相対移動を許容するように設けてあるので、足場と外壁部とを互いに対向させて水平方向に相対移動可能に設けてある建築用足場でありながら、大量の足場用資材を特に使用したり、外壁部に沿って足場設置用の広いスペースを特に確保する必要なく、足場を外壁部に支持させて、風荷重などによる足場の外壁部に対する遠近方向への転倒を確実に防止できる。
[Action and effect]
Without fixing the scaffold and the outer wall part to each other, the scaffold and the outer wall part are provided so as to be relatively movable in a horizontal direction in a posture facing each other, and the scaffold and the outer wall part are arranged in a perspective direction with respect to the outer wall part of the scaffold. Since the engagement mechanism that engages so as to prevent the body from falling is provided to allow the relative movement along the relative movement direction of the scaffold and the outer wall, the scaffold and the outer wall are opposed to each other horizontally. Although it is a building scaffold that can be moved relative to the direction, there is no need to use a large amount of scaffolding materials or to secure a large space for installing a scaffold along the outer wall. By supporting it, it is possible to reliably prevent the scaffold from falling in the perspective direction with respect to the outer wall portion of the scaffold due to wind load or the like.

そして、足場と外壁部とを足場の外壁部に対する遠近方向への倒れを阻止可能に係合する係合機構を、相対移動方向に沿わせて足場に固定したガイドレールとそのガイドレールに係合するように外壁部に着脱自在に固定した係合部材により構成して、足場と外壁部との相対移動方向に沿ってその相対移動を許容するように設けてあるので、ガイドレールの長さを選択することによって、足場の倒れを阻止しながら、所望の距離に亘って相対移動を許容できるように係合させ易い。 Then, engaging a scaffold and an outer wall portion of the engaging mechanism for preventing engage the inclination of the direction of access for the outer wall of the scaffold, and its guide rail along a relative movement direction guide rails fixed to the scaffold The length of the guide rail is such that the engaging member is detachably fixed to the outer wall portion so that the relative movement between the scaffold and the outer wall portion is allowed. By selecting, it is easy to engage so as to allow relative movement over a desired distance while preventing the scaffold from falling down.

さらに、ガイドレールを足場に固定し、係合部材を外壁部に着脱自在に固定してあるので、足場をガイドレールで補強できるとともに、外壁部の相対移動方向に沿う長さが、足場の相対移動方向に沿う長さに比べて長い場合は、足場に対向しない位置に相対移動した外壁部分に固定してある係合部材を、足場に対向する位置に相対移動する外壁部分に付け替えることにより、特に長いガイドレールを設けることなく、足場の倒れを阻止しながら、所望の距離に亘って相対移動を許容できるように簡便に係合させ易い。 Furthermore, since the guide rail is fixed to the scaffold and the engaging member is detachably fixed to the outer wall portion, the scaffold can be reinforced with the guide rail, and the length along the relative movement direction of the outer wall portion is relative to the scaffold. If it is longer than the length along the moving direction, by replacing the engaging member fixed to the outer wall portion that has moved relative to the position that does not face the scaffold, with the outer wall portion that moves relative to the position that faces the scaffold, In particular, without providing a long guide rail, it is easy to engage easily so as to allow relative movement over a desired distance while preventing the scaffold from falling down.

本発明の第特徴構成は、前記ガイドレールと前記係合部材とを遊びを設けて係合させてある点にある。 A second characteristic configuration of the present invention is that the guide rail and the engaging member are engaged with each other by providing play.

〔作用及び効果〕
ガイドレールと係合部材との係合部とを遊びを設けて係合させてあるので、足場の倒れを阻止しながら、足場と外壁部とを円滑に相対移動させ易いとともに、ガイドレールと係合部材とを、特に高い精度を要することなく、簡便に取り付けることができる。
[Action and effect]
Since the guide rail and the engaging portion of the engaging member are engaged with each other by providing play, the scaffold and the outer wall portion can be smoothly and relatively moved while preventing the scaffold from falling down, and the guide rail and the engaging member are engaged with each other. The joint member can be easily attached without particularly high accuracy.

本発明の第特徴構成は、前記係合部材を、前記ガイドレールに沿って転動可能に係合するローラを設けて構成してある点にある。 A third characteristic configuration of the present invention is that the engaging member is provided with a roller that is slidably engaged along the guide rail.

〔作用及び効果〕
係合部材を、ガイドレールに沿って転動可能に係合するローラを設けて構成してあるので、係合部材とガイドレールとの摩擦抵抗を軽減して、足場と外壁部とを容易に相対移動させることができる。
[Action and effect]
Since the engaging member is provided with a roller that is slidably engaged along the guide rail, the frictional resistance between the engaging member and the guide rail is reduced, and the scaffold and the outer wall portion can be easily formed. It can be moved relative.

以下に本発明の実施の形態を図面に基づいて説明する。
〔第1実施形態〕
図1,図2は、建屋を構築するために建築中(組み立て中)の略一定長さの建屋ユニット(建築物の一例)Bと、その建屋ユニットBの外壁部1に対向させて足場2を設けてある本発明による建築用足場Aとを示す。
Embodiments of the present invention will be described below with reference to the drawings.
[First Embodiment]
1 and 2 show a building unit (an example of a building) B having a substantially constant length during construction (assembling) and a scaffold 2 facing the outer wall 1 of the building unit B in order to construct a building. The construction scaffold A according to the present invention is provided.

前記建屋ユニットBは、組み立てヤードCの所定位置において建屋ユニットBの柱や梁などを組み立てたあと、その建屋骨組み3をチルタンク4に載せて仕上げヤードDに移動させ、その仕上げヤードDの所定位置において屋根材や壁材を取り付けて完成させるもので、組み立てヤードCにおいて、先行して完成させた完成建屋ユニットB1に柱や梁などを連結して建屋骨組み3を組み立て、完成建屋ユニットB1を仕上げヤードDから建屋設置場所に向けて送り出しながら、後続建屋ユニットB2の建屋骨組み3を仕上げヤードDに移動させて建屋ユニットBを完成させるトラベリング工法で、複数の建屋ユニットBを連結してなる建屋を建屋設置場所に設置できるように構成してある。   The building unit B, after assembling the pillars and beams of the building unit B at a predetermined position of the assembly yard C, moves the building framework 3 onto the chill tank 4 and moves it to the finishing yard D. In the assembly yard C, the building frame 3 is assembled by connecting columns and beams to the completed building unit B1 completed in advance in the assembly yard C, and the finished building unit B1 is finished. A building constructed by connecting a plurality of building units B by a traveling method for completing the building unit B by moving the building frame 3 of the subsequent building unit B2 to the finishing yard D while sending it from the yard D toward the building installation location. It is configured so that it can be installed at the building installation location.

前記足場2は、パイプ製の足場資材5を組み立てて構成したもので、組み立てヤードC及び仕上げヤードDの建屋移動方向Eに沿う左右両脇に、建屋ユニットBの屋根6近くに至る高さ(本実施形態では約30m)で外壁部1に対向するように設置して、チルタンク4に載せて移動する完成建屋ユニットB1及び組み立て中の建屋ユニットB2に対して相対移動可能に設けてある。   The scaffold 2 is constructed by assembling pipe-made scaffold materials 5, and has a height (near the roof 6 of the building unit B) on both the left and right sides along the building moving direction E of the assembly yard C and the finishing yard D ( In this embodiment, it is installed so as to face the outer wall 1 at about 30 m), and is provided so as to be relatively movable with respect to the completed building unit B1 moving on the chill tank 4 and the building unit B2 being assembled.

尚、図1,図2では、組み立てヤードC及び仕上げヤードDの建屋移動方向Eに沿う一側脇に設置してある足場2のみを示している。   1 and 2, only the scaffold 2 installed on one side along the building moving direction E of the assembly yard C and the finishing yard D is shown.

そして、足場2と外壁部1とを足場2の外壁部1に対する遠近方向への倒れを阻止可能に係合する係合機構7を、足場2と外壁部1との相対移動方向に沿ってその相対移動を許容するように、上下複数箇所に設けてある。   Then, an engagement mechanism 7 that engages the scaffold 2 and the outer wall 1 so as to prevent the scaffold 2 from falling in the perspective direction with respect to the outer wall 1 is provided along the relative movement direction of the scaffold 2 and the outer wall 1. It is provided at a plurality of locations above and below to allow relative movement.

前記係合機構7は、図3,図4に示すように、建屋移動方向Eに沿わせて足場2に略水平に着脱自在に固定してあるガイドレール8に、外壁部1に着脱自在に固定した複数の係合部材9を係合させて構成してある。   As sh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, the engagement mechanism 7 is detachably attached to the outer wall 1 on a guide rail 8 that is detachably fixed to the scaffold 2 along the building moving direction E. A plurality of fixed engaging members 9 are engaged.

前記ガイドレール8は、鋼製溝形材10の二本を、両溝形材10の間に一連の隙間が形成されるように溝側を上下方向から互いに対向させた状態で、ベース板11に固定して構成してあり、クランプ金具12で足場資材5に略水平に着脱自在に固定してある。   The guide rail 8 has two steel channel members 10 in a state where the groove sides face each other in the vertical direction so that a series of gaps are formed between both channel members 10. It is configured to be fixed to the scaffold material 5 with the clamp fitting 12 so as to be detachable substantially horizontally.

前記係合部材9の各々は、両溝形材10に亘って係合する周溝13を備えていて、両溝形材10間の隙間に沿って転動可能に係合する金属製或いは樹脂製の遊転ローラを設けて構成してあり、この遊転ローラ9をローラ支持フレーム14に回転自在に、かつ、回転軸芯X方向の位置を調節自在に支持して、建屋骨組み3の外壁部1に略水平に組み付けてある素屋根梁15に対して着脱自在に設けてある。   Each of the engaging members 9 is provided with a circumferential groove 13 that engages across both groove members 10, and is made of metal or resin that engages so as to roll along the gap between both groove members 10. An idle wall roller of the building framework 3 is constructed by providing an idle roller made of steel, and supporting the idle roller 9 on the roller support frame 14 so as to be rotatable and to adjust the position in the rotation axis X direction. It is provided so as to be detachable with respect to the bare roof beam 15 assembled to the part 1 substantially horizontally.

前記ローラ支持フレーム14は、遊転ローラ9をアーム長手方向に沿う軸芯X周りで回転自在に支持する支持アーム16に、支持アーム16の水平方向の倒れを防止する補助アーム17を溶接などで斜めに固定して構成してあり、遊転ローラ9の周溝13が両溝形材10に亘って、軸芯X方向にも上下方向にも遊びがある状態で係合するように、補助アーム17が建屋移動方向Eの前方側に位置し、かつ、支持アーム16が建屋移動方向Eに直交する方向に向けて略水平に突出する姿勢で、支持アーム16と補助アーム17との各々をブルマン18で素屋根梁15に着脱自在に固定してある。   The roller support frame 14 is formed by welding an auxiliary arm 17 that prevents the support arm 16 from falling in the horizontal direction on a support arm 16 that rotatably supports the idler roller 9 around an axis X along the longitudinal direction of the arm. It is configured to be fixed obliquely, so that the circumferential groove 13 of the idler roller 9 is engaged with both the groove members 10 with play in both the axial direction X and the vertical direction. Each of the support arm 16 and the auxiliary arm 17 is placed in a posture in which the arm 17 is positioned on the front side in the building movement direction E and the support arm 16 protrudes substantially horizontally in a direction orthogonal to the building movement direction E. It is detachably fixed to the bare roof beam 15 by a bullman 18.

前記建屋ユニットBに遊転ローラ9を固定してガイドレール8に係合させる方法を説明する。
図5(イ)は、仕上げヤードDの所定位置で完成させた完成建屋ユニットB1に、組み立てヤードCの所定位置で組み立てが完了した後続建屋ユニットB2の建屋骨組み3を連結してある状態を示し、足場2に固定したブラケット足場19を使用して、後続建屋ユニットB2の素屋根梁15の建屋移動方向前方側に、遊転ローラ8の周溝13が両溝形材10に亘って係合するように、ローラ支持フレーム14を固定する。
A method of fixing the idle roller 9 to the building unit B and engaging with the guide rail 8 will be described.
FIG. 5A shows a state where the building framework 3 of the subsequent building unit B2 that has been assembled at the predetermined position of the assembly yard C is connected to the completed building unit B1 completed at the predetermined position of the finishing yard D. Using the bracket scaffold 19 fixed to the scaffold 2, the circumferential groove 13 of the free-rolling roller 8 is engaged across both groove members 10 on the front side in the building movement direction of the bare roof beam 15 of the subsequent building unit B 2. In this manner, the roller support frame 14 is fixed.

次に、牽引ワイヤやジャッキなどを使用して、後続建屋ユニットB2の素屋根梁15の建屋移動方向中間部がブラケット足場19の近くに位置するまで、建屋骨組み3を仕上げヤードD側に移動させるとともに、完成建屋ユニットB1を仕上げヤードDから送り出し、図5(ロ)に示すように、素屋根梁15の建屋移動方向中間部に、遊転ローラ8の周溝13が両溝形材10に亘って係合するように、ローラ支持フレーム14を固定する。   Next, the building framework 3 is moved to the finishing yard D side by using a pulling wire, a jack, or the like until the intermediate portion of the building roof beam 15 of the subsequent building unit B2 is located near the bracket scaffold 19. At the same time, the completed building unit B1 is sent out from the finishing yard D, and as shown in FIG. The roller support frame 14 is fixed so as to be engaged with each other.

次に、後続建屋ユニットB2の素屋根梁15の建屋移動方向後端側がブラケット足場19の近くに位置するまで、建屋骨組み3を仕上げヤードD側に更に移動させるとともに、完成建屋ユニットB1を仕上げヤードDから更に送り出し、図5(ハ)に示すように、素屋根梁15の建屋移動方向後端側に、遊転ローラ9の周溝13が両溝形材10に亘って係合するように、ローラ支持フレーム14(14a)を固定する。   Next, the building framework 3 is further moved to the finishing yard D side until the rear end side of the building roof beam 15 of the subsequent building unit B2 is located near the bracket scaffold 19, and the completed building unit B1 is finished in the finishing yard. As shown in FIG. 5 (c), the circumferential groove 13 of the idler roller 9 is engaged across both groove members 10 on the rear end side in the building moving direction of the bare roof beam 15. The roller support frame 14 (14a) is fixed.

次に、後続建屋ユニットB2の建屋骨組み3の全体が仕上げヤードDの所定位置に位置するまで、建屋骨組み3を仕上げヤードD側に更に移動させるとともに、完成建屋ユニットB1を仕上げヤードDから更に送り出し、組み立てヤードCにおいて更に後続する後続建屋ユニットB3の建屋骨組み3の組み立てが完了すると、図5(ニ)に示すように、後続建屋ユニットB2の素屋根梁15の建屋移動方向後端側に固定してあるローラ支持フレーム14aを外して、そのローラ支持フレーム14aを、後続建屋ユニットB3の建屋骨組み3の素屋根梁15の建屋移動方向前方側に、遊転ローラ9の周溝13が両溝形材10に亘って係合するように固定する。   Next, the building framework 3 is further moved to the finishing yard D side until the entire building framework 3 of the subsequent building unit B2 is located at a predetermined position of the finishing yard D, and the completed building unit B1 is further sent out from the finishing yard D. When the assembly of the building framework 3 of the subsequent building unit B3 that continues further in the assembly yard C is completed, as shown in FIG. 5 (d), it is fixed to the rear end side in the building movement direction of the bare roof beam 15 of the subsequent building unit B2. The roller support frame 14a is removed, and the roller support frame 14a is disposed on the front side in the building movement direction of the bare roof beam 15 of the building framework 3 of the subsequent building unit B3. It fixes so that it may engage over the shape member 10. FIG.

また、仕上げヤードDから送り出された完成建屋ユニットB1に固定してあるローラ支持フレーム14は、遊転ローラ9のガイドレール8との係合が外れると、適宜、素屋根梁15から外して、後続建屋ユニットB3の建屋骨組み3に固定して、繰り返し使用できるようにしてある。   Further, the roller support frame 14 fixed to the completed building unit B1 sent out from the finishing yard D is appropriately removed from the bare roof beam 15 when the idler roller 9 is disengaged from the guide rail 8, It is fixed to the building framework 3 of the subsequent building unit B3 so that it can be used repeatedly.
